She was dressed in a white tunic lined with ermine and squirrel fur. In 1558, Mary Queen of Scots wore white throughout her marriage ceremony to the soon-to-be King of France, even though white was a color of mourning for French queens on the time. White attire did not symbolize virginity and even purity, but rather were costlier and tougher to keep clear, and thus communicated the status and wealth

earer.

Sometimes known as ‘sailor’ or ‘Sabrina’, the bateau neckline exudes French-style stylish. If you are lucky sufficient to have a protracted, swan-like neck or broad shoulders, it could probably be for you, and can also enhance a smaller bust line.
